    In a significant development in the investigation of the recent Air India crash, authorities have successfully retrieved and downloaded crucial data from the aircraft’s black boxes. The breakthrough offers critical insights into the moments leading up to the tragedy, potentially shedding light on the cause of the accident. Officials involved in the probe are now analyzing the information in hopes of unraveling the sequence of events that led to the crash, marking a pivotal step toward enhancing aviation safety and accountability.

    In Air India Crash Probe Breakthrough Data Downloaded From Black Boxes

    Investigators have successfully retrieved critical data from the flight recorders of the ill-fated Air India aircraft, marking a crucial step forward in understanding the causes behind the tragic crash. The so-called “black boxes,” comprising the Cockpit Voice Recorder (CVR) and Flight Data Recorder (FDR), contain invaluable information on the aircraft’s performance, pilot communications, and technical parameters leading up to the accident.
